On This Day In Aviation History

1916 - First flight of the Royal Aircraft Factory R.E.8 [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Royal_Air ... tory_R.E.8]

1941 - First flight of the Brewster SB2A Buccaneer [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Brewster_SB2A_Buccaneer]

1955 - First flight of the Tupolev Tu-104 (NATO reporting name: Camel) [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Tupolev_Tu-104]

1959 - First flight of the Dassault Mirage IV [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dassault_Mirage_IV]

1961 - First flight of the HAL HF-24 Marut [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/HAL_HF-24_Marut]

1997 - First flight of the Eurocopter EC155 [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Eurocopter_EC155]

On this date in 1986, B-47E-25-DT Stratojet, AF SN 52-0166 became the last B-47 flight when the jet was restored to flight status and flown from NAWC China Lake to Castle AFB for display.
